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en | Yes | No | DIY fixes are usually straightforward and inexpensive, but be sure to follow proper safety protocols. |
| Large water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ary to prevent further damage and ensure the area is completely dry and safe. |
| Mold growth in a small area | No | Yes | Mold can spread quickly, and DIY cleaning may not be enough to remove it entirely. A professional can ensure the area is properly sanitized and cleaned. |
| Water damage in a large or complex area (e.g., basement, crawl space) |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ary to navigate the complexity of the area and ensure all damage is addressed. |
| Water damage with significant structural damage | No | Yes | Structural damage needs professional attention to ensure the integrity of your property and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age with health concerns (e.g., mold, bacteria) | No | Yes | A professional will take the necessary precautions to ensure your health and safety during the restoration process. |

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ost In Calvert, AL
The cost of Floor Water Damage Restoration in Calvert, AL, dep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are competitive and transparent, ensuring you get the best value for your money. Here’s a breakdown of the typical price ranges for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Structural Drying and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, type of materials needed |
| Sanitizing and Cleaning | $300 – $1,500 | Size of area, type of cleaning solutions needed |
| Final Inspection and Touch-ups | $100 – $500 | Complexity of the job, number of technicians needed |
| Whole-House Restoration | $5,000 – $20,000 | Size of the house, type of materials needed |
